About the role

The VP, Revenue Applied AI & Data leads the strategy, architecture, and hands‑on execution of AI‑driven solutions across the Revenue organization. This role owns the end‑to‑end applied AI function for Revenue — spanning use‑case identification, solution architecture, data foundations, model development, vendor strategy, and budget — and is accountable for delivering scalable, production‑ready AI capabilities that drive measurable business outcomes. Operating with a lean, production‑first delivery model, the VP both sets direction and personally builds, ensuring AI moves from concept to deployed, monitored, value‑generating systems embedded in everyday Revenue workflows.

Your

contribution will be:
  • Architect, build, and deploy production‑grade AI agents and LLM‑powered solutions embedded within daily internal Revenue workflows.
  • Evaluate and execute build‑vs‑buy‑vs‑platform decisions — leveraging Nintex Automation CE and K2 where appropriate, partnering with Product and Engineering on shared infrastructure, and developing custom agentic systems using Claude and other foundation models for unique internal needs.
  • Own the AI function’s budget, vendor relationships, and technical roadmap for internal applications.
  • Define, track, and report key performance indicators (KPIs) that link AI investments to measurable outcomes in efficiency, revenue generation, and cost optimization; present progress to leadership on a monthly basis.
  • Establish clear release standards for AI initiatives, ensuring each deployment has defined outcomes, an accountable workflow owner, and production monitoring in place.
  • Communicate Revenue AI strategy, investment rationale, and return on investment (ROI) to executive leadership — including the CEO, CFO, and Board — translating technical concepts into audience‑appropriate insights.
  • Design and deploy AI‑driven automation across the full customer lifecycle, including pipeline qualification, proposal generation, onboarding, Q  preparation, renewal forecasting, and customer health scoring.
  • Lead the automation of finance workflows, including reporting, variance analysis, contract analysis, audit preparation, and spend optimization.
  • Identify and eliminate manual, high‑friction operational processes across the organization; enable scalable adoption through self‑service AI tools for business teams.
  • Own and evolve the data engineering foundation, including data pipelines, warehouse architecture, data quality standards, and governed access layers.
  • Develop and operationalize proprietary models trained on Nintex data (customer, product usage, and operational data) to improve retention, expansion forecasting, and business visibility.
  • Establish and enforce governance frameworks for responsible, reliable, and scalable AI deployment, including model evaluation, monitoring, and data privacy and security standards.
  • Operate with a lean, outcome‑focused delivery model, driving measurable impact through cross‑functional partnerships with business and technical teams.
